Engineered to Deliver Reliable Coolant Distribution

Coolant flanges play a vital role within the engine cooling system, providing secure connection points between the engine, coolant hoses and auxiliary cooling components. Acting as a junction for coolant flow, they help ensure coolant is distributed efficiently throughout the system to maintain stable operating temperatures and protect the engine from overheating.

Modern coolant flanges often incorporate additional features including temperature sensors, bleed valves and multiple hose outlets, making them an increasingly important component within today's cooling systems. TechASSIST: Product Support and Information

The coolant flange forms an important connection point within the cooling system. It: • Directs coolant flow between the engine and cooling system components • Provides secure mounting points for coolant hoses • Maintains a leak-free seal between cooling system components • Supports stable engine operating temperatures • May incorporate coolant temperature sensors or bleed valves • Helps ensure efficient coolant circulation throughout the vehicle Although often overlooked, a damaged coolant flange can quickly lead to coolant loss, overheating and costly engine damage if not addressed promptly.

Why Do They Fail?

Coolant flanges operate in a harsh environment and commonly fail due to:

  • Plastic degradation caused by repeated heating and cooling cycles
  • Cracking around hose connections or mounting points
  • Gasket or seal deterioration allowing coolant leaks
  • Excessive cooling system pressure
  • Corrosion on metal-bodied variants
  • Damage during hose removal or previous repairs
  • Failure of integrated temperature sensors where fitted

Symptoms of a Failing Coolant Flange

  • Visible coolant leaks around the engine
  • Coolant smell from the engine bay
  • Low coolant warning light illuminated
  • Frequent coolant top-ups required
  • Engine overheating
  • White or coloured coolant residue around hose connections
  • Temperature gauge irregularities on sensor-equipped units
  • Engine management fault codes where integrated sensors have failed

Fitting Tips

  • Always replace seals, O-rings and gaskets supplied with the flange
  • Inspect connected hoses for signs of swelling, cracking or deterioration
  • Clean mating surfaces thoroughly before installation
  • Avoid over tightening mounting bolts, particularly on plastic flanges
  • Check operation of any integrated temperature sensors before completing the repair
  • Refill and bleed the cooling system according to manufacturer procedures
  • Verify there are no leaks once the engine reaches operating temperature
